Woolly mammoths also had a close relative, the larger-bodied Columbian massive (Mammuthus columbianus), which lived additional southern in The United States and Canada. Current hereditary proof is suggesting that woolly as well as Columbian mammoths interbred in the areas where they overlapped. Turquoise arrays in color from deep and also pale blue, deep green, as well as green brownish. The strength of blue arise from the level of copper in the rock, and the greener tones reveal a greater concentration of aluminum. This gorgeous gemstone has actually been valued for countless years, with proof of active mines in Egypt dated at 6,000 BC.
